0029915: Porting to VC 2017 : Regressions in Modeling Algorithms on VC 2017
[occt.git] / src / Bnd / Bnd_Box2d.cxx
index f06127f..02263e9 100644 (file)
@@ -5,8 +5,8 @@
 //
 // This file is part of Open CASCADE Technology software library.
 //
-// This library is free software; you can redistribute it and / or modify it
-// under the terms of the GNU Lesser General Public version 2.1 as published
+// This library is free software; you can redistribute it and/or modify it under
+// the terms of the GNU Lesser General Public License version 2.1 as published
 // by the Free Software Foundation, with special exception defined in the file
 // OCCT_LGPL_EXCEPTION.txt. Consult the file LICENSE_LGPL_21.txt included in OCCT
 // distribution for complete text of the license and disclaimer of any warranty.
 // Alternatively, this file may be used under the terms of Open CASCADE
 // commercial license or contractual agreement.
 
-#include <Bnd_Box2d.ixx>
-#include <Standard_Stream.hxx>
+
+#include <Bnd_Box2d.hxx>
 #include <gp.hxx>
-//-- #include <Precision.hxx> Precision::Infinite() -> 1e+100
+#include <gp_Dir2d.hxx>
+#include <gp_Pnt2d.hxx>
+#include <gp_Trsf2d.hxx>
+#include <Standard_ConstructionError.hxx>
+#include <Standard_Stream.hxx>
 
+//-- #include <Precision.hxx> Precision::Infinite() -> 1e+100
 //=======================================================================
 //function : Update
 //purpose  : 
 //=======================================================================
-
 void Bnd_Box2d::Update (const Standard_Real x, const Standard_Real y, 
                        const Standard_Real X, const Standard_Real Y)
 {
@@ -73,7 +77,7 @@ void Bnd_Box2d::Get (Standard_Real& x, Standard_Real& y,
                     Standard_Real& Xm, Standard_Real& Ym) const
 {
   if(Flags & VoidMask)
-    Standard_ConstructionError::Raise("Bnd_Box is void");
+    throw Standard_ConstructionError("Bnd_Box is void");
   Standard_Real pinf = 1e+100; //-- Precision::Infinite();
   if (Flags & XminMask) x = -pinf;
   else                  x =  Xmin-Gap;